Presenting Mr. JaMichael Brown, also known as, Big Baby!

The family of a baby boy born in Texas couldn’t be more proud and a mother more weary with their newest blessing.  Texas is known for doing big things, but they had no idea that their would be a Texas-size baby coming into their lives.  While doctors told them to expect a larger than normal baby, nothing could’ve prepared them for 16 pounds of fun!

That’s right!  Mr. JaMichael Brown was born to parents Janet Johnson and Michael Brown on Monday and they were interviewed by Ann Curry of the Today show.  The father is 6 foot 5 inches himself.  But, his son is well on his way to catching up with his dad as soon as he possibly can.  Not only was he born weighing a whopping 16 pounds, but he is also two feet tall, with a head 15 inches in circumference and a 17-inch chest.
